      <description>&lt;P&gt;I am trying to integrate the ArcGIS Runtime SDK for Java (v. 200.0) into an application running on Ubuntu 20.04 ARM (running on NVIDA Orin). &amp;nbsp;The platform is aarch64. &amp;nbsp;This architecture is available for Mac M1, but the Linux (LX64) version only supports x86_64. &amp;nbsp;Is there any plans to create an arm version of the LX64 libraries? &amp;nbsp;The embedded beta for QT includes the runtime.so for ARM but of course, not the Java runtime so.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;I am using ArcGIS Maps SDK for Java 200.4.0 and am running the JAR on a Raspberry Pi 4 Model B (AArch64) with Ubuntu 22.04. When referencing the "SpatialReferences" class, the following exception is thrown:&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;UL&gt;&lt;LI&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: Could not initialize class com.esri.arcgisruntime.geometry.SpatialReferences&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Exception java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: /root/.arcgis/200.4.0/jniLibs/LX64/libruntimecore.so: /root/.arcgis/200.4.0/jniLibs/LX64/libruntimecore.so: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ory (Possible cause: can't load AMD 64 .so on a AARCH64 platform)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;/UL&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;Any updates on porting the Java SDK to AArch64?&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
